On Wed, 8 Oct 2003, Elton Woo wrote:

> Well it looks like I already *have* the newer version of gnome-python2-canvas
> installed already. Also, why is up2date (apparently) doing rpm -ivh,
> instead of *Uvh*? These are after just updating and a reboot:
> # rpm -qa | grep gnome-python
> gnome-python2-gtkhtml2-2.0.0-1
> gnome-python2-gtkhtml2-2.0.0-2
> gnome-python2-canvas-2.0.0-1
> gnome-python2-2.0.0-1
> gnome-python2-bonobo-2.0.0-1
> gnome-python2-bonobo-2.0.0-2
> gnome-python2-canvas-2.0.0-2

I am not sure what you have done here, you can get this if an rpm update
aborts for some reason. Delete the newer ones and then up2date them, to
make sure you have a good copy.

> Likewise, up2date refuses to install open-office 1.1.0-1.
> NOTE: it doesn'e even *list* the current version on
> my system (openoffice-i18n-1.0.2-4):

That is a known bug due to a minor packaging error. Either delete the old
openoffice packages first, or wait for the fixed package (probably
tomorrow).
